10.4's DVD player has always had that preference pane. It's for making "HD-DVDs" in DVD Studio Pro 4. They're not real HD-DVDs, they're regular discs with your HD videos encoded in h.264, and apparently only playable in Macs running 10.4. Possibly anything else that can play h.264 videos as well, so maybe some PCs.
